|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960 |
- {
- "name": "critters",
- "version": "0.0.16",
- "description": "Inline critical CSS and lazy-load the rest.",
- "main": "dist/critters.js",
- "module": "dist/critters.mjs",
- "source": "src/index.js",
- "exports": {
- "import": "./dist/critters.mjs",
- "require": "./dist/critters.js",
- "default": "./dist/critters.mjs"
- },
- "typings": "src/index.d.ts",
- "files": [
- "src",
- "dist"
- ],
- "license": "Apache-2.0",
- "author": "The Chromium Authors",
- "contributors": [
- {
- "name": "Jason Miller",
- "email": "developit@google.com"
- },
- {
- "name": "Janicklas Ralph",
- "email": "janicklas@google.com"
- }
- ],
- "keywords": [
- "critical css",
- "inline css",
- "critical",
- "critters",
- "webpack plugin",
- "performance"
- ],
- "repository": {
- "type": "git",
- "url": "https://github.com/GoogleChromeLabs/critters",
- "directory": "packages/critters"
- },
- "scripts": {
- "build": "microbundle --target node --no-sourcemap -f cjs,esm",
- "docs": "documentation readme -q --no-markdown-toc -a public -s Usage --sort-order alpha src",
- "prepare": "npm run -s build"
- },
- "dependencies": {
- "chalk": "^4.1.0",
- "css-select": "^4.2.0",
- "parse5": "^6.0.1",
- "parse5-htmlparser2-tree-adapter": "^6.0.1",
- "postcss": "^8.3.7",
- "pretty-bytes": "^5.3.0"
- },
- "devDependencies": {
- "documentation": "^13.0.2",
- "microbundle": "^0.12.3"
- }
- }
|